How we got here

Mr. Fix IT Geeks started as a consulting firm that reviewed IT contracts for small businesses. We would sit down with the vendor's scope of work, compare it to what was actually deployed, and document the gaps. The same problems showed up everywhere: backup systems that had never been tested, monitoring tools that only checked whether machines were on, and patch schedules weeks or months behind. Businesses with five employees were paying the same per-device rates as companies with two hundred, getting the same neglect either way. After enough of those audits, we stopped writing reports about what providers should do and started building a service that does it. We designed every tier around what we kept flagging as missing: verified backups, real-time alerting, honest monthly reporting, and pricing that makes sense for a company with fifteen devices or fewer.

Our approach to managed IT

Every service we offer traces back to something we found broken during an audit. We saw providers running monitoring that only checked if a device was online, so we built ours around Zabbix with custom thresholds for disk health, CPU, memory, and network per client. We saw backup vendors who could not produce a successful restore log, so we deployed UrBackup with Backblaze B2 and built automated restore testing into the process. We saw security sold as a checkbox, so we paired managed endpoint detection with Wazuh for file integrity monitoring and vulnerability scanning. The tool stack is open-source where reliability and transparency matter, and best-in-class commercial where the risk of getting it wrong is too high. Every tool was selected because we had written audit findings about the thing it replaces.
